The venue should be the right size for the number of guests you expect. It should also be in an easily accessible location and have enough parking spaces available on site. It should also have bathrooms! Don\u2019t overlook basic amenities. Renting a bathroom trailer, a tent or a heater can account for way more than you expected.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Booking the venue, photographer or other vendors with whom you feel the most comfortable takes precedence over choosing the lowest price.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Wedding planning doesn\u2019t have to be expensive, but you must stay organized.<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Before you start wedding planning, set a budget for your entire wedding and stick to it. You may want to consider setting individual spending limits for each item that you plan on buying (e.g., $1,000 on attire\u2014but consider that alterations can be at least $500).<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Be realistic about what you can afford\u2014don\u2019t go over your set budget! Even if people tell you they\u2019ll pay for things like bridesmaid dresses or having their favorite band play at your reception, don\u2019t accept those gifts unless they\u2019re within your budgeted amount. Remember: You could be responsible for paying for this all, sometimes a well-meaning family member or friend\u2019s funds can fall through.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Make a list of items that are important to YOU and make sure they\u2019re within your budget before proceeding further with any planning decisions (i.e., making sure there\u2019s enough room in the venue).<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p>Wedding planning can be a lot of fun, but it can also be stressful.
